Two kids aged 4 and 10 killed in horror ‘drink drive’ crash between a car and a lorry on the M1
2021-08-11 00:00:00.0     太阳报-英国新闻     原网页

       

       TWO kids aged four and ten have died in a horror "drink-drive" crash between a car and a lorry on the M1.

       Thames Valley Police are now appealing for witnesses following the tragic collision near Milton Keynes yesterday.

       The kids were the passengers of the white Vauxhall Astra that collided with an HGV at around 11:10pm on the M1 northbound between junctions 14 and 15.

       Their next of kin have been informed and are being supported by specially trained officers.

       Another child passenger in the Astra and the driver were taken to hospital with injuries but have since been discharged.

       The driver of the HGV was uninjured.

       A 35-year-old woman from Derby has been arrested on suspicion of causing death by dangerous driving and driving a motor vehicle when above the prescribed limit of alcohol.

       She remains in custody.

       The crash caused ten hours of road delays that saw cars in a standstill all the way back to Bedford.

       Investigating officer, Sergeant Dominic Mahon, of the Serious Collision Investigation Unit at Bicester, said: “My thoughts remain with the family of the two children who sadly died at this extremely difficult time.

       “We are appealing for anyone who may have witnessed this collision or anyone who may have dash-cam footage that may have captured what happened or either of the vehicles prior to the collision to please get in touch.

       “You can make a report by calling 101 or online, quoting reference 43210356500.”
